As a plastic surgeon in Quebec City, I can attest to the safety and efficacy of cheek implants when performed by a qualified and experienced professional. Cheek implants, also known as malar implants, are a popular cosmetic procedure that can enhance the contours of the face and provide a more youthful, balanced appearance.
The procedure involves the insertion of synthetic implants, typically made of silicone or other biocompatible materials, into the cheek area to add volume and definition. This can be particularly beneficial for individuals who have naturally flat or recessed cheeks, or those who have experienced volume loss due to aging or weight fluctuations.
When it comes to the safety of cheek implants in Quebec City, it is important to consider several factors. Firstly, the procedure should be performed by a board-certified plastic surgeon with extensive experience in facial contouring and implant placement. This ensures that the implants are strategically positioned to achieve the desired aesthetic result while minimizing the risk of complications.
Additionally, the quality and biocompatibility of the implant materials used are crucial. In Quebec City, reputable plastic surgeons will only utilize implants that are approved by regulatory bodies, such as Health Canada, and have a proven track record of safety and durability.
The risks associated with cheek implants, when performed by a qualified professional, are generally low. Potential complications may include infection, implant displacement, or the development of scar tissue. However, these are relatively uncommon when proper surgical techniques and post-operative care are implemented.
To ensure the safety of the procedure, patients in Quebec City should thoroughly research their chosen plastic surgeon, inquire about their qualifications and experience, and discuss the specific risks and benefits of the procedure. Additionally, patients should follow all pre-and post-operative instructions provided by their surgeon to minimize the risk of complications and achieve optimal results.
In conclusion, cheek implants can be a safe and effective cosmetic procedure when performed by a skilled plastic surgeon in Quebec City. By choosing a qualified professional and following the recommended guidelines, patients can achieve a more balanced and youthful facial appearance with minimal risk. As with any surgical procedure, it is essential to have a thorough consultation and carefully weigh the potential benefits and risks before proceeding.
